Recognizing Remodeling Waste Types

Home remodels generate a wide variety of waste materials depending on the scope of the project. Frequent remodeling waste consists of drywall, cabinets, flooring, and construction scraps. Each phase of a remodel can produce different types of waste, often in large quantities. Anticipating these types ensures smoother disposal. When waste types are anticipated, removal becomes more organized. This awareness prevents debris from accumulating unexpectedly.

Understanding the types of renovation waste also promotes efficient cleanup. Some materials are heavy and difficult to move, while others are lighter but more numerous. Mixing debris without a plan can make removal more difficult. Identifying waste categories allows for smoother disposal and handling. This preparation reduces delays caused by cluttered work areas.
